We're working with an ambitious and growing wealth management business seeking an experienced compliance professional to lead its regulatory oversight and adviser supervision framework.
This is not a traditional compliance role.
The business is investing heavily in technology, automation and AI-driven processes, creating an opportunity for an individual who wants to modernise compliance functions, improve adviser outcomes and influence strategic decision-making at the highest level.
Reporting directly into senior leadership, you'll play a key role in ensuring the organisation maintains strong governance, delivers excellent customer outcomes and continues to evolve its regulatory framework alongside business growth.
Role & Responsibilities: π
- Leading the Compliance function and acting as the key subject matter expert on regulatory matters.
- Managing and developing the firm's adviser supervision and competency framework.
- Providing guidance and challenge to senior stakeholders on regulatory risk and governance matters.
- Designing and delivering compliance monitoring activities, thematic reviews and assurance programmes.
- Overseeing complaints, regulatory incidents and risk events, ensuring lessons learned translate into meaningful improvements.
- Supporting Consumer Duty governance, customer outcome monitoring and board reporting.
- Managing relationships with regulatory bodies, auditors and external compliance partners.
- Driving regulatory change projects and ensuring new requirements are successfully implemented.
- Leading financial crime oversight activities including AML controls, monitoring and risk assessments.
- Reviewing and strengthening policies, procedures and governance frameworks across the business.
- Producing insightful management information and reporting for senior leaders and the Board.
- Supporting strategic projects including acquisitions, integrations, operational improvements and business transformation initiatives.
- Championing the use of technology, automation and AI to improve monitoring, reporting and control effectiveness.
Do you have the following to apply? β
- Minimum Level 4 Diploma in Financial Planning (or equivalent)
- Senior compliance experience within a regulated financial planning, wealth management or advice environment.
- Used AI or automation tools within compliance, risk or operational environments (beneficial).
